Recording a still image on a tape – Tape Photo recording
Self-timer tape photo recording
– DCR-TRV320 only
You can record still images on tapes with the self-timer. This mode is useful when you
want to record yourself. You can also use the Remote Commander for this operation.
(1) In the standby mode, press (self-timer). The (self-timer) indicator
appears on the LCD screen or in the viewfinder.
(2) Press PHOTO firmly.
Self-timer starts counting down from 10 with a beep sound. In the last two
seconds of the countdown, the beep sound gets faster, then recording starts
automatically.
To cancel self-timer recording
Press (self-timer) so that the indicator disappears from the LCD or viewfinder
screen while your camcorder is in the standby mode. You cannot cancel self-timer
recording with the Remote Commander.
Note
The self-timer recording mode is automatically cancelled when:
Self-timer recording is finished.
– The POWER switch is set to OFF (CHARGE) or VTR.
